A single user password supports the instant and power-on 
password functions. 
When setting up the various passwords, keep the following in 
mind:
The user password can be set up under the supervisor 
password.
The supervisor password must be set before the user 
password, or the user password must be deleted and then 
re-entered after the supervisor password is set.
Using an instant password
An instant password secures your system with a single 
keystroke. Use this feature when you leave your desk for a 
few minutes and do not want to turn off the computer.
To use an instant password, press 
Fn
, then press 
F1
. This 
freezes the keyboard and TouchPad, and blanks the screen. 
An instant password has no effect on an optional USB mouse 
or trackball.
To unlock your system, press Enter and the Windows Logon 
screen will appear. Select your user name and enter your 
password, if any.
Setting a user password
To register a password for the power-on password functions:
1
Click StartAll ProgramsToshibaUtilities, then click 
Toshiba Assist.
The TOSHIBA Assist window appears.
2
On the left side, select Secure.
3
Select the User Password icon.
4
Click Registered.
